About the position:The role involves assisting in the preparation, presentation, and delivery of high-quality meals and beverages to residents, ensuring they meet individual dietary requirements and preferences as specified by the dietician, speech therapist, or clinical care team.
Key Responsibilities:
* Assist in menu planning and contribute to the implementation, monitoring, and documentation of the Food Safety Program (FSP) in partnership with the Chef Supervisor.
* Maintain a clean and safe work environment by promoting safe work practices.
* Support the ongoing quality review of the FSP, including tasks like recording temperatures and receipting goods.
* Ensure the timely and friendly delivery of meals, and report any concerns regarding food and beverages to the Registered Nurse in charge.
Requirements:
* Fitness for work over a 7-day period, morning and afternoon shifts.
* Able to acquire current NDIS check.
* Experience in residential aged care and hospitality or catering.
* Current flu-vax.
